A modern car battery is designed to start the engine, not to power accessories for extended periods. A typical phone charger draws about 5-10 watts. Leaving a phone plugged in overnight in a parked car might drain the battery, but it would take a very long time—likely over 24 hours—to drain it to the point where the car won't start. The bigger danger is parasitic drain from other aftermarket devices like dash cams or from an aging, weak battery.
The key factor is the state of the engine. When the engine is running, the alternator generates more than enough electricity to power all accessories, including phone chargers, and simultaneously recharge the battery. The electrical system's voltage when running is typically around 13.5-14.5 volts. It's only when the engine is off that the phone draws power directly from the 12-volt battery.
The actual impact depends on several variables, which are compared below:
| Factor | Low Risk Scenario | High Risk Scenario |
|---|---|---|
| Battery Health | New, fully charged battery | Old, weak, or already depleted battery |
| Engine Status | Engine running | Engine off for an extended period (e.g., overnight) |
| Charger Draw | Single standard 5W charger | Multiple high-power chargers (e.g., 18W+ for tablets) |
| Battery Capacity | Large capacity battery (e.g., 70Ah) | Small capacity battery (e.g., 40Ah) |
| Additional Loads | No other accessories draining power | Dash cam, interior lights, or stereo also left on |
| Time | Charging for 30 minutes after turning off the car | Left plugged in for 12+ hours |
To be safe, make it a habit to unplug all accessories before you turn off the engine and exit the car. If you frequently need to charge devices while the car is parked, consider investing in a portable jump starter pack as a precaution. The main takeaway is that the phone charger itself is rarely the sole culprit; it's usually the final straw for a battery already compromised by age or other hidden drains.

Think of it like a bucket of water. Your car is the bucket. Starting the engine takes a big splash of water. Charging a phone is just a slow, steady drip. A healthy, full bucket can handle the drip for a long time. But if the bucket is already half-empty or has a small leak (an old battery), that constant drip could empty it enough that you can't start the car. The drip alone isn't the problem; it's the combination with an already weak system.

It's all about the alternator. When your engine is on, the alternator is like a power plant, supplying all the electricity your car needs and refilling the . The phone charger is a tiny load for it. The danger is when the engine is off. Then, the charger is slowly sipping from the battery's limited reserve. For most people who just forget to unplug it while running errands, it's fine. The risk is for those who leave it plugged in for days in an airport parking lot or have a battery that's on its last legs.

From an electrical standpoint, the power draw is minimal. A standard car has a capacity of around 45-60 amp-hours (Ah). A phone charger might draw 1-2 amps. In theory, it could take dozens of hours to fully drain a healthy battery. However, a car battery is designed for short, high-current bursts for starting, not deep cycling. Repeatedly draining it even slightly can sulfate the plates and shorten its lifespan. So, while one incident might not leave you stranded, the cumulative effect of the habit can lead to a premature battery failure.
